MacOS Catalina Security & Privacy Window Keeps Appearing at Logon/Startup

Every time I login, whether it is at startup or just logging in again, the Security & Privacy dialog shows up with full disk access highlighted. However, there are no new programs that are unchecked in the list. This is happening on two different computers, 2018 Mac Mini and a new 2019 MacBook Air with the latest version of Catalina installed on both. Is there any way to see what program is triggering the dialog to open, even if it's not appearing in the list in the dialog? Once I close the dialog, it does not appear for the rest of the session.

Verify System Preferences are not in the log-in items for some reason.


>System Preferences>Users & Groups>select your account Log-in Items


unlock the pad lock to make changes. Use the - (+/-) to remove items from the list



If no change, to get a good look at your System config. for conflicts or issues, you can run this utility http://etrecheck.com

If you need help interpreting the report you can post it here in its entirety in the "Additional Text" box in the editing toolbar below, in your reply.


You can set its preference to "Allow full Disk Access", with this you get a digest of issues from the last 7 days that are saved in your system.

------------------------------------------------


Other option might be to try a SafeBoot to clear system caches in an effort to resolve: SafeBoot https://support.apple.com/en-us/HT201262

Takes noticeable longer to get to the login screen, does a 5-15 minute disk repair before it fully boots up, and certain system caches get cleared and rebuilt, including dynamic loader cache, etc. Login and test.
